What companies run services between Pennsylvania, USA and York, England?

There is no direct connection from Pennsylvania to York. However, you can take the train to Airport Terminal A, walk to Philadelphia International Airport (PHL) airport, fly to Leeds Bradford International Airport (LBA), walk to Leeds Bradford Airport, take the bus to Leeds Fire Station, take the bus to City Square F, walk to Leeds, then take the train to York. Alternatively, you can take the train to Airport Terminal A, walk to Philadelphia International Airport (PHL) airport, fly to Manchester Airport (MAN), walk to Manchester Airport, then take the train to York.
